Contents: I. Head and Neck: 1. Introduction to the head and neck. 2. The cervical vertebrae. 3. The skull. 4. The scalp and face. 5. The posterior triangle of the neck. 6. The anterior triangle of the neck. 7. The back. 8. The cranial cavity. 9. Deep dissection of neck. 10. The prevertebral region. 11. The orbit. 12. The eyeball. 13. Organs of hearing and equilibrium. 14. The parotid region. 15. The temple and infratemporal region. 16. The submandibular region. 17. The mouth and pharynx. 18. The tongue. 19. The cavity of the nose. 20. The larynx. 21. The contents of the vertebral canal. 22. The joints of the neck.23. MCQs for Part 1: Head and neck. II. The brain and spinal cord: 24. Introduction to the brain and spinal cord. 25. The meninges of the brain. 26. The blood vessels of the brain. 27. The spinal cord. 28. The brain stem. 29. The cerebellum. 30. The diencephalon. 31. The cerebrum. 32. The ventricular system. 33. MCQs for Part 2: brain and spinal cord . III. Cross-sectional anatomy: 34. Cross-sectional anatomy of the head and neck . Answers to MCQs. The new 16th edition of Cunningham's has been thoroughly revised for the modern-day anatomy student. The language has been simplified for easy understanding making this textbook ideal for students at undergraduate levels. Each dissection reflects current medical school teaching and is now broken down into clear step-by-step instructions. New learning features prepare students for the dissection lab, university examinations and clinical practice. Completely updated full colour artwork brings the friendly explanations to life. Following a logical structure, each chapter explains in a clear friendly manner the key knowledge expected of students. Improved diagrams with clear labelling and full colour illustrate key anatomical features bringing the text to life. Learning objectives introduce each dissection and clear step-by-step instructions make it easy to follow in the dissection lab. Throughout the book new clinical application boxes and radiology images explain how anatomy relates to clinical medical practice. At the end of each part, multiple choice questions allow students to quickly review their knowledge before checking the answers in 'Answers to MCQs'. Student friendly and richly illustrated, this new edition of Cunningham's brings expert anatomical teaching to the modern day student of medicine, dentistry and allied health sciences. Retaining the trustworthy authority of the previous editions, this sixteenth edition offers a contemporary account of this excellent practical anatomy book.
